Audiovox PROVD8 Car Video System User Manual


 
Wired Headphones
There are two 1/8” headphone jacks on the PROVD8
that can be used with any standard wired stereo
headphones. These jacks are controlled by the volume
up / down buttons on the PROVD8 remote control.
Remove the protective plastic cover to access the
jacks. Remember to replace the cover when the jacks
are not in use.
Wired FM Modulator
The PROVD8 is equipped with an outboard RF
modulator that allows you to listen to the PROVD8 audio
signal by tuning your vehicle’s radio to the selected
frequency, (88.3, 88.7 or 89.1). This feature is accessed
by using the FM transmitter buttons on the remote (On/
Off, Select). Whenever the RF modulator is on,
broadcast reception on the vehicle’s radio will be poor.
Switching off the FM modulator will allow normal radio
reception.
Press the FM Transmitter On/Off switch to turn the FM
Modulator on. The LCD screen will display the frequency
setting of the FM Modulator. Pressing the Select button
will change the Frequency of the FM modulator (88.3/
88.7/89.1)
AV1
The AV1 input may be connected to a Video Cassette
Player (VCP), video game system, or other audio / video
device. To access the AV1 input, turn the PROVD8 on
and press the source button on the PROVD8 or the
Source button on the remote control until “AV1” is
displayed on the screen. Turn the video source
component on with its power button or remote control.
The PROVD8 is now ready to play the audio and video
signals from the source connected to the AV1 input.
AUX
A video game system, Camcorder or other audio / video
device may be connected to the AUX Input jacks (see
Figure 1. for the location of these jacks) To access the
AUX source, turn the PROVD8 on and press the source
button on the PROVD8 or the Source button on the
remote control until “AUX” is displayed on the screen.
Turn the video source component on with its power
button or remote control. The PROVD8 is now ready
to play the audio and video signals from the source
connected to the AUX input.
